
Mon Dec 09 19:08:15 UTC 2024: ## Three Dead, Dozens Injured in Mumbai Bus Crash
**Mumbai, India** – A BEST Electric bus crashed into multiple vehicles and pedestrians in Kurla, Mumbai, on Monday night, resulting in at least three deaths and 22 injuries. The accident occurred around 9:50 PM near Anjum-E-Islam school on SG Barve Marg.
According to the Brihanmumbai Municipal Corporation (BMC), the bus, traveling from Kurla railway station to LBS Road, veered out of control before colliding with an estimated 30-40 vehicles and pedestrians. Two individuals died at the scene, and a third succumbed to their injuries at Bhabha Hospital. The injured were transported to the hospital by private vehicles and ambulances.
The cause of the accident is under investigation, but initial reports suggest the driver lost control of the bus (MH-01, EM – 8228). The bus ultimately crashed into the gates of a residential society and an RCC column before coming to a stop. Police have cordoned off the area and are investigating the incident. A large crowd gathered at the scene following the accident.
This incident follows a separate accident just two days prior, where a teenage boy driving a Porsche crashed into parked motorcycles in Bandra. Fortunately, no injuries were reported in that incident.
